The first is “Go BestFriend 2.0,” the sequel to his 2017 Jahlil Beats-produced track. G-Eazy and Rich the Kid assisted the follow-up.
“Having G-Eazy and Rich the Kid on this song is dope,” Casanova said in a statement to Complex. “My arms reach to the Bay, to the A, back to where I stay! Brooklyn I got us!”

Casanova also came through with the official music video for the menacing track “Gripped Up.” Speaking about making the video, Casanova said: “Shooting 'Gripped Up' video was crazy. I was scared to drive the hearse at first but it ended up being cool.”
